CANTU
CANTU is a Texas oil lease in Starr County, Railroad Commission district 04, operated by WJW Operating Co.,LLC.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from April 2001 to August 2026, totalling 34,372 barrels. The lease is shut in.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 55 barrels a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was June 2019, at 895 barrels.
